Electricity production from renewable sources, excluding hydroelectric in Indonesia
Indonesia: Electricity production from renewable sources, excluding hydroelectric was 31.07 billion kWh in 2021. ◆ Volatile
Electricity production from renewable sources, excluding hydroelectric in Indonesia, 1990–2021
Source: IEA Energy Statistics Data Browser, International Energy Agency (IEA). Measured in kWh.
Analysis
Indonesia recorded 31.07 billion kWh for electricity production from renewable sources, excluding hydroelectric in 2021. That is the highest value across all 32 years on record.
Compared with earlier readings it is up 10.6% on the previous year and up 71.6% over ten years.
Over the whole period, electricity production from renewable sources, excluding hydroelectric in Indonesia peaked at 31.07 billion kWh in 2021 and was at its lowest, 1.05 billion kWh, in 1991.
Indonesia ranks 18th of 209 countries on this measure, in the top 10%.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.
Averages by decade
| Decade | Average | Lowest | Highest | Years |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 1.88 billion kWh | 1.05 billion kWh | 2.73 billion kWh | 10 |
| 2000s | 12.02 billion kWh | 9.58 billion kWh | 15.46 billion kWh | 10 |
| 2010s | 21.04 billion kWh | 17.24 billion kWh | 26.56 billion kWh | 10 |
| 2020s | 29.59 billion kWh | 28.10 billion kWh | 31.07 billion kWh | 2 |

About this data
Electricity production from renewable sources in kilowatt-hour (kWh), excluding hydroelectric, includes geothermal, solar, tides, wind, biomass, and biofuels.
